Changeset View
Changeset View
Standalone View
Standalone View
sys/modules/crypto/Makefile
Show All 17 Lines | |||||
.PATH: ${LIBSODIUM}/crypto_onetimeauth/poly1305/donna | .PATH: ${LIBSODIUM}/crypto_onetimeauth/poly1305/donna | ||||
.PATH: ${LIBSODIUM}/crypto_verify/sodium | .PATH: ${LIBSODIUM}/crypto_verify/sodium | ||||
.PATH: ${SRCTOP}/sys/crypto/libsodium | .PATH: ${SRCTOP}/sys/crypto/libsodium | ||||
KMOD = crypto | KMOD = crypto | ||||
SRCS = crypto.c cryptodev_if.c | SRCS = crypto.c cryptodev_if.c | ||||
SRCS += criov.c cryptosoft.c xform.c | SRCS += criov.c cryptosoft.c xform.c | ||||
SRCS += cast.c cryptodeflate.c rmd160.c rijndael-alg-fst.c rijndael-api.c rijndael-api-fst.c | SRCS += cast.c cryptodeflate.c rmd160.c rijndael-alg-fst.c rijndael-api.c rijndael-api-fst.c | ||||
CFLAGS.cryptodeflate.c += -I${SRCTOP}/contrib/zlib -I${SRCTOP}/sys/contrib/zstd/lib/freebsd -DZ_PREFIX | |||||
SRCS += skipjack.c bf_enc.c bf_ecb.c bf_skey.c | SRCS += skipjack.c bf_enc.c bf_ecb.c bf_skey.c | ||||
SRCS += camellia.c camellia-api.c | SRCS += camellia.c camellia-api.c | ||||
SRCS += des_ecb.c des_enc.c des_setkey.c | SRCS += des_ecb.c des_enc.c des_setkey.c | ||||
SRCS += sha1.c sha256c.c sha512c.c | SRCS += sha1.c sha256c.c sha512c.c | ||||
SRCS += skein.c skein_block.c | SRCS += skein.c skein_block.c | ||||
# unroll the 256 and 512 loops, half unroll the 1024 | # unroll the 256 and 512 loops, half unroll the 1024 | ||||
CFLAGS+= -DSKEIN_LOOP=995 | CFLAGS+= -DSKEIN_LOOP=995 | ||||
.if exists(${MACHINE_ARCH}/skein_block_asm.s) | .if exists(${MACHINE_ARCH}/skein_block_asm.s) | ||||
▲ Show 20 Lines • Show All 41 Lines • Show Last 20 Lines |